Output 8e57c1fbdb3ea83c7e426532f46fb8d59e4c366d1f0aea85622b29494df23738:61

value
253056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aba5d8d4aa87b4125784606a5b96bed1dad6a26 OP_EQUAL
address
3P69JL5Dm1iL5sNfEuawdFXbAv7JQEHTuy
transaction
8e57c1fbdb3ea83c7e426532f46fb8d59e4c366d1f0aea85622b29494df23738
spent
true